Raiding a mummy is tantamount to robbing it of its possessions.
Therefore it is something that he or his family possesses in life, not necessarily the body.
After all, to summon a Servant, you had to have a catalyst that has the strongest affinity of that Servant to summon it.
Emiya Kiritsugu got Avalon, for instance. That alone made sure that he will summon a specific Saber class Servant.
Round Table pieces are more of a random roulette of Servants. They can summon King Arthur there, but it's more of a chance basis. Lancelot, Tristan, Mordred and Gawain may also be summoned from that one. If you added lines for Mad Enhancement though, it may be slightly likely that you will summon Lancelot due to his legend.
